What People Really Think About Public Smoking

Thursday, March 4, 2004 Save & Share

Research shows that most people do not want complete bans on smoking in public places.

They do want restrictions, particularly in restaurants, but these are being delivered through the voluntary Public Places Charter.

This pamphlet details the research showing what people really think.
